// Heads up, support folks: this constant caps websocket
// compression on Chatterline relays. Higher values save
// bandwidth but spike CPU on older kiosks, which shows up
// as "laggy typing" tickets. Don't bump it without load
// testing first. The build this default shipped in is
// identified by the token below.

session token of yajof-bagef = htk4_937d

## Env Vars: Audit-Log Viewer (Scribewatch)

Hey on-call — if Scribewatch shows a blank page or a spinning loader, it's almost always config, not an outage. The viewer reads from the Inkpool event store and needs three vars: the store URL, the default retention window, and a read credential. The first two are set by the deploy templates, so don't touch those. The read credential is the one that goes stale when we rotate quarterly. It lives in the viewer's env file on the next line:

sealed setting: COURIER_KEY29=170ad45524657711572101e080d15

When the Gildmere Theatre seat-map renderer shows stale holds, first confirm the hold-expiry worker is draining; a backed-up queue is the usual cause. Then force a re-render for the affected performance only — never flush the full venue cache during an on-sale window, as the Orpine hall layouts take minutes to rebuild. Note the renderer build token for the sync below, appended after this line.

build token for kagaf-hahof: htk14_9d3d4d26d7d8de

## Configuration

DeployBeak posts deploy status updates to your chat rooms, and plugins hook in via the same config file. Most settings live in `.env` at the repo root — channel mappings, poll intervals, the usual. Plugin authors: read values through the provided `cfg()` helper rather than `process.env` directly, or hot-reload breaks. Before your plugin can authenticate against the DeployBeak relay, add the following line to your `.env`:

sealed setting: RELAY_SECRET13=bca49b02a6971

Subject: DR Drill — TailLantern CLI

Hi all,

Next Tuesday we run the disaster-recovery drill for TailLantern, our internal log-tailing CLI. Please install the latest build beforehand and confirm you can reach the Ferngate staging cluster. During the drill, the primary auth service is deliberately offline, so the CLI falls back to offline recovery mode. Authenticate using the passphrase below.

unlock words, tagaf-hahif: ralwyn-lammir-rusax-sormir